스크린샷 자동으로 넣어서 사례게시글 만들어주는 클로드 스킬 만들기 도즈언!

🎯 무엇을 만들려고 했나?

GPTers 사례 게시글을 자동으로 작성하는 Claude 스킬을 만들고 싶었습니다.

  • 스크린샷 폴더에서 이미지 자동 수집

  • 인터뷰로 정보 수집

  • 마크다운 + HTML 자동 생성

하지만 예상치 못한 오류를 만나 우여곡절을 겪었습니다. 😅

📝 상세 진행 과정

1단계: 1차 스킬 제작 시도

처음에는 욕심내서 이런 요구사항으로 스킬을 만들었습니다:

요구사항 프롬프트:

스크린샷 폴더에서 이미지를 읽어서 사례게시글에 해당하는
이미지를 찾고 내용에 맞는 위치에 넣어서 게시글을 완성해줘.


최대 30개 이미지 처리
이미지 내용 자동 분석 및 매칭
마크다운 파일 작성 및 클립보드 복사

2단계: 테스트 및 Usage Policy 오류 발견

스킬을 테스트해봤더니 다음 오류가 발생했습니다:

API Error: Claude Code is unable to respond to this request,
which appears to violate our Usage Policy
(https://www.anthropic.com/legal/aup).

오류 원인 분석:

  • 30개 이미지를 한 번에 처리 (리소스 과다 사용)

  • Claude는 멀티모달 모델이라 이미지를 직접 분석하는데, 너무 많은 이미지 요청

  • 너무 공격적인 완전 자동화

  • 스킬 권한이 과도함

3단계: 기존 스킬 삭제

문제를 해결하기 위해 처음부터 다시 시작하기로 결정했습니다.

프롬프트:

기존에 작성한 클로드 스킬을 제거해줘

실행 명령어:

스킬 위치 확인
ls -la /c/Users/user/.claude/skills

스킬 삭제

rm -rf /c/Users/user/.claude/skills/screenshot-case-study-writer

삭제 확인

ls -la /c/Users/user/.claude/skills

4단계: 가능 여부 재확인

다른 AI에게도 자문을 구했습니다:

프롬프트:

너무 스킬이 복잡해서 그럴수도 있고 권한이 너무 과해서
일수도 있는데 이런 부분도 고려해야할것 같은데
어떻게 하는게 좋을까?

AI 조언:

  • 이미지 개수를 30개 → 15개로 제한

  • 날짜 기반 필터링으로 필요한 이미지만 선별

  • 사용자 확인 단계 추가

  • 단계별 처리로 분산

5단계: 2차 스킬 작성 (개선 버전)

조언을 바탕으로 스킬을 다시 작성했습니다:

핵심 개선사항:

| 항목 | Before | After |

|------|---------|-------|

| 이미지 개수 | 30개 | 최대 15개 |

| 처리 방식 | 전체 분석 | 날짜 기반 필터링 |

| 자동화 수준 | 완전 자동 | 단계별 확인 |

| 확인 방법 | 채팅창 출력 | 옵시디언 임시 파일 |

추가 요청 프롬프트:

글을 다 작성하고 나에게 한번 확인을 받고 수정해야할 사항이 있다면
수정을 하고 그다음을 진행하면 좋겠어.

옵시디언에서 바로 볼 수 있으면 이미지 확인도 쉬울 것 같아.

스킬 설정 (YAML):

name: screenshot-case-study-writer
limits:
  - 최대 이미지: 15개
  - 날짜 범위: 필수 입력
  - 이미지 분석: 선택적
workflow:
  1. 인터뷰로 정보 수집
  2. 스크린샷 선별
  3. 임시 파일 저장 (_DRAFT_게시글초안.md)
  4. 옵시디언에서 확인 및 수정
  5. 최종 저장 + HTML 클립보드 복사

6단계: 이미지 경로 문제 해결

옵시디언에서 이미지가 안 보이는 문제를 해결했습니다:

프롬프트:

혹시 스크린샷 바로 가기 링크를 옵시디언 볼트안에 넣어서
하는건 안될까?

해결 방법 - Junction 생성:

PowerShell로 Junction(바로가기) 생성
New-Item -ItemType Junction `
  -Path '옵시디언볼트/아카식레코드/스크린샷' `
  -Target '원본스크린샷폴더'

이미지 경로 형식:

💡 배운 점

핵심 교훈:

1. 미리 물어보고 시작하자 - 애매한 부분은 AI에게 먼저 확인

2. 간소화가 성공의 비결 - 완벽함보다 핵심 기능 우선

3. Usage Policy 준수 - 과한 자동화는 제한될 수 있음

실전 팁:

✅ Do: 단계별 작업, 이미지 15개 이하, 사용자 확인 필수
❌ Don't: 완벽주의, 한 번에 모든 것 처리, 과도한 자동화

📚 참고 자료

---

결론:시행착오를 겪었지만 실용적인 스킬 완성! 오류 나면 간소화하세요. 🎉

------

<사족>

참고로 이 사례게시글도 클로드 스킬로 작성했어요.ㅎㅎ

명령어랑 프롬프트는 잘 찾아서 넣어주긴하는데 이미지넣는건 실패했네요..

Html로는 이미지까지 모두 넣어서 완성된 형태로 작성하는것까지는 성공했는데... 문제는 지피터스 에디터가 html을 받지 않네요 ㅠㅜ

비록 실패했지만 다른 html을 받는 에디터에서는 충분히 사용할수 있을거 같아요.

1
3개의 답글

뉴스레터 무료 구독

👉 이 게시글도 읽어보세요